Output 6613d6d3b7a5563943c692489a255e417eb4c146defb189627b1bb0b698a6b8d:0

value
50000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 23005a0859f1af124047a2983db3423b8c0533dc7a9d944cf4da229687db1f0d
address
tb1pyvq95zze7xh3ysz852vrmv6z8wxq2v7u02wegn85mg3fdp7mruxscjehnf
transaction
6613d6d3b7a5563943c692489a255e417eb4c146defb189627b1bb0b698a6b8d
confirmations
54704
spent
true